... and a few that cannot be forgotten ...

 

Quicksilver (1986)

Kevin Bacon is a Wall Street wunderkind fired after losing his golden touch. Reduced to working as a bicycle messenger, he learns lessons in humility and concern for others, especially his fellow gofers, who are threatened by merciless pushers. 106 m in.

Director: Tom Donnelly Cast: Kevin Bacon, Lou Dinos, Michael Fox, Jami Gertz, Michael Kaye, Paul Rodriguez

 

Real Genius (1985)

When some college science whizzes learn that their latest project is to be used as a government weapon, they sabotage the works in this wild comedy. Val Kilmer, Gabe Jarret, Michelle Meyrink and William Atherton star. 106 min.

Category: Comedy Director: Martha Coolidge

Cast: William Atherton, Patti D'Arbanville, Severn Darden, Dean Devlin, Deborah Foreman, Chip Johnson, Val Kilmer, Ed Lauter, Michelle Meyrink, Yuji Okumoto

 

Vice Versa (1988)

What happens when strait-laced dad Judge Reinhold and fun-loving son Fred Savage exchange bodies? One hilarious mix-up after another, as the transposed pair must try to live each other's life. With Swoosie Kurtz, Corinne Bohrer. 97 min.

Category: Comedy Director: Brian Gilbert

Cast: Corinne Bohrer, James Hong, Jane Kaczmarek, Swoosie Kurtz, William Prince, David Proval, Judge Reinhold, Fred Savage, Alan Shearman

 

Loverboy (1989)

Saucy farce about a shy young man (Patrick Dempsey) whose pizza job soon has him making some ``special deliveries'' to the sexiest women in town. With Kirstie Alley, Carrie Fisher, Kate Jackson, Barbara Carrera and Nancy Valen. 108 min.

Category: Comedy Director: Joan Micklin Silver

Cast: Kirstie Alley, Barbara Carrera, Bernie Coulson, Patrick Dempsey, Carrie Fisher, Robert Ginty, Rebecca Holden, Kate Jackson, Robert Picardo, Vic Tayback, Nancy Valen

 

White Water Summer (1987)

A young man (Kevin Bacon) takes a group of boys on a wilderness trip in the rugged Sierras, and together they must face a series of challenges from the land around them...and from within themselves. With Sean Astin, K.C. Martel. 90 min.

Category: Action & Adventure Director: Jeff Bleckner

Cast: Matt Adler, Sean Astin, Kevin Bacon, K.C. Martel, Caroline McWilliams, Jonathan Ward

 

... and two that we can't forget, even though they are not "80's films" ...

 

Breaking Away (1979)

Winning story of four college town youths unsure about life after high school and how one boy's obsession with bicycle racing offers an escape from the boredom of daily life. Funny, rousing tale from Oscar-winning screenwriter Steven Tesich stars Dennis Christopher, Daniel Stern, Dennis Quaid, Paul Dooley. 100 min.

Category: Comedy Director: Peter Yates

Cast: John Ashton, Barbara Barrie, Hart Bochner, Dennis Christopher, Paul Dooley, Robyn Douglass, Jackie Earle Haley, Peter Maloney, Dennis Quaid, P.J. Soles, Daniel Stern, Amy Wright

 

Toy Soldiers (1991)

Suspenseful thriller about a group of South American terrorists who take over a New England military school populated by rebellious teenage boys. Instead of giving in to the terrorists' strong-arm tactics, the boys devise an ingenious plan to fight back. Sean Astin, Wil Wheaton, Keith Coogan, Denholm Elliott and Louis Gossett, Jr. star. 111 min.

Category: Action & Adventure Director: Daniel Petrie Jr.

Cast: Mason Adams, Sean Astin, Michael Champion, Keith Coogan, Andrew Divoff, Denholm Elliott, R. Lee Ermey, Louis Gossett Jr., George Perez, John Shaw, Richard Travis, Richard Warner, Wil Wheaton
